Full Job Description
Overview

The Manager, Marketing Technology (AI Data & Analytics) will be responsible for strategic marketing and business development data analysis of data stored within Foley's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system and other sources as needed to help identify the best possible revenue and operational efficiency opportunities. This Manager will be heavily involved in marketing technology and using AI to enhance, analyze, and output strategic data and further to ensure the right types of data are collected and stored with data hygiene guardrails and rules to ensure quality of data. To that end, a part of this role will be analyzing the current state of data quality and making recommendations to improve the data. The incumbent understands leading marketing technology practices across the B2B marketing industry. This role also requires a significant investment in data analytics and the Manager should be highly focused on finding new ways to use strategic data to give Foley a competitive advantage in the legal industry.

In support of transparency and equity in the workplace, Foley provides salary ranges for all positions. The figures below represent the full compensation range of this position. The actual offered amount will be between the range minimum and midpoint based on the following factors: education, experience, geographic market, and internal pay equity at Foley.
Milwaukee - $116,900 to $175,400
Chicago - $128,600 to $192,900
Washington D.C. - $140,300 to $210,500

About Foley & Lardner

Foley & Lardner is a law firm that provides legal services to clients in a variety of industries, including healthcare, energy, and technology. The firm was founded in 1842 and is headquartered in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. Foley & Lardner offers a range of legal services, including corporate law, intellectual property law, and litigation. The firm has offices in the United States, Europe, and Asia, and serves clients around the world. Foley & Lardner is known for its expertise in healthcare law, and has been recognized as one of the top healthcare law firms in the United States.
